Still Settling

I am still housesitting, and in the meantime, looking for a more permanent place. I had not counted on there being such a shortage of rentals in Kodiak, and on rents being so excessively high! It has been quite the sticker shock for me - to look at 450-sq. foot apartments going for $950/mo., or new, roomy apartments for $1375/mo. ! Maybe I am just picky - but so many places don't measure up to my standards of cleanliness or just decor. Of course, I left my own home that Bren & I decorated with our own hands and invested 'sweat' equity in over the past 5 years. It's decorated in our collaborative style of Asian modern with art work in all the rooms. The other hard part is finding a place with room and light to do my artwork. I need a space where I can make a mess, and where I can 'spread out', and that has good lighting. That is a challenge! I have been feeling increasingly discouraged.

It doesn't help that I am such a creature of habit, and a homebody. I miss my home, and my things - books, masks, art supplies - and most of all, my life-partner and my pets. Until I had traveled back to my home town, and slept in a strange house the first few nights, it hadn't occurred to me that I have never lived by myself. When I went away to college, I had roommates. Then my son was born, and after college, I lived with my mother for 10 years. Then I moved to Seattle and have lived with Bren for the past 11 years. It isn't that I can't stand to be alone - on the contrary, I've always relished my 'alone time' - having the house to myself for a few hours, or getting up early on a Saturday and drinking my coffee while reading or sketching, or just musing.

This is just a different phase of my life. I am too busy now to be lonely - there is always my mother to visit, or errands to run, or another apartment to view. The sun has lengthened her hours in the sky from 8 a.m. to 8:30 p.m. The cold winter days have persisted, and the hiking trails remain icy, but I can enjoy a brisk walk after work across the bridge to Near Island, toward the boat harbor.
